Three GEMB cards also. Sams's club, Sam's club Discover, Lowe's. Funny thing about Lowe's. Got it last December, they pulled TU on me and my score was 680...ish. Got $6750 to start, which was more than my other two combined at the time. Just for kicks, I hit the Luv button on Lowe's web site after waiting six months. Got CLI to 10K instantly.....about fell out of my chair. About to hit the Luv button on my Discover when my payment posts. They want six months though, make that six STATEMENTS between CLI's.....no go before that. I hear others tell about 4 mo. CLI's, but not from my experience over the past three years. GEMB has been very good to me so far. I pay multiple times per cycle though, and I always pay the minimum due as soon as the statement posts on-line. Go ahead and give them a go. The other account history should be a positive for you. Good luck.
